Why Gypsum is added to clinker?

Gypsum plays a very important role in controlling the rate of hardening of the cement. During the cement manufacturing process, upon the cooling of clinker, a small amount of gypsum is introduced during the final grinding process. Gypsum is added to control the “setting of cement”.

Considering this, what happens when gypsum is added to cement?

When cement is mixed with water, it becomes hard over a period of time. This is called setting of cement. Gypsum is often added to Portland cement to prevent early hardening or “flash setting”, allowing a longer working time. Gypsum slows down the setting of cement so that cement is adequately hardened.

In this regard, how much gypsum is added to cement?

For ordinary Portland cement, it remains between 3 to 4% and in case of Quick setting cement, it can be reduced up to 2.5%. The main purpose of adding gypsum in the cement is to slow down the hydration process of cement once it is mixed with water.

Why does cement harden on addition of water?

The water causes the hardening of concrete through a process called hydration. Hydration is a chemical reaction in which the major compounds in cement form chemical bonds with water molecules and become hydrates or hydration products.

How does gypsum slow down hydration?

The main purpose of adding gypsum in the cement is to slow down the hydration process of cement once it is mixed with water. The process involved in hydration of cement is that, when the water is added into cement, it starts reacting with the C3A and hardens.

Why cement is called Portland cement?

Its name is derived from its similarity to Portland stone, a type of building stone quarried on the Isle of Portland in Dorset, England. In his 1824 cement patent, Joseph Aspdin called his invention "Portland cement" because of its resemblance to Portland stone.

What is the formula of gypsum?

Gypsum is a soft sulfate mineral composed of calcium sulfate dihydrate, with the chemical formula CaSO4·2H2O. It is widely mined and is used as a fertilizer and as the main constituent in many forms of plaster, blackboard/sidewalk chalk, and drywall.

Why clinker is used in cement?

Use of Clinker: Conversion to Cement Gypsum added to and ground with clinker regulates the setting time and gives the most important property of cement, compressive strength. It also prevents agglomeration and coating of the powder at the surface of balls and mill wall.

What is the formula of cement?

Chemical composition Portland cement is made up of four main compounds: tricalcium silicate (3CaO · SiO2), dicalcium silicate (2CaO · SiO2), tricalcium aluminate (3CaO · Al2O3), and a tetra-calcium aluminoferrite (4CaO · Al2O3Fe2O3).

Which cement is used for dam construction?

Low Heat Cement is generally used for the dam construction. This type of cement is produced by lowering the amount of tricalcium aluminate (C3A) & di-calcium silicate (C2S).

What is the difference between halite and gypsum?

Halite has three perfect cleavages that form at right angles to form cubes. Gypsum crystals only have one perfect cleavage direction. The other two cleavage directions are not as pronounced, so broken gypsum crystals tend to form rhomb-shaped fragments, rather than cubes.

Is Gypsum safe to eat?

Gypsum (calcium sulfate) is recognized as acceptable for human consumption by the U.S. Food and Drug Administration for use as a dietary source of calcium, to condition water used in brewing beer, to control the tartness and clarity of wine, and as an ingredient in canned vegetables, flour, white bread, ice cream, blue

What is the use of gypsum in agriculture?

Gypsum is chemically (Calcium Sulphate dihydrate). It acts as a source of two main plant nutrients i.e Calcium and Sulphur. Basically gypsum is used for Soil amendments to improve Chemical and physical properties of soil. It is most commonly used amendment for sodic soil reclamation.

What are admixtures?

Admixtures are natural or manufactured chemicals which are added to the concrete before or during mix- ing. The most often used admixtures are air-entraining agents, water reducers, water-reducing retarders and accelerators.

What is difference between setting and hardening of cement?

Setting of cement refers to changes of cement paste from a fluid to rigid state. Setting differs from Hardening of cement. The term 'Hardening' refers to the gain of strength of a set cement paste, although during setting the cement paste acquires some strength. Hardening or stiffening: It happens after setting state.

Why lime is added to cement?

Pure lime mortars behave as if they are flexible and lime cement mortars are slower hardening and remain more flexible than cement sand mortars. Lime, therefore, enhances the ability of the brickwork to accommodate stresses caused by building movement and cyclical changes without excessive cracking.

Which compound has the maximum heat of hydration?

C3A generates 320cal/g heat of hydration which is highest. Also it reacts fast with water.

What is water cement ratio?

The watercement ratio is the ratio of the weight of water to the weight of cement used in a concrete mix. A lower ratio leads to higher strength and durability, but may make the mix difficult to work with and form. Workability can be resolved with the use of plasticizers or super-plasticizers.
